使用Maven管理项目时,如果连不到远程仓库,但是本地仓库有对应的jar包;此时若还是报错找不到对应jar包的原因,是因为maven3.x版本在从远程仓库下载资源后,会生成对应的_remote.repositories文件,以标识该资源的来源。如果该jar包对应目录内有这个_remote.repositories文件,那么项目就默认不会从本地仓库加载jar包,会默认从远程maven仓库上下载jar包,这样就会导致报错。

解决方法是将_remote.repositories文件删除,然后重新引入就好了。

————————————————

版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。

原文链接:https://blog.csdn.net/heng_dmzg/article/details/139929708